Islamic fasting (Sawm) is one of the Five Pillars of Islam, where Muslims abstain from food, drink, and other physical needs during daylight hours for the entire month of Ramadan.

Key Features

  • Abstaining from food, drink, smoking, and sexual relations during daylight hours
  • Increasing acts of worship, such as reading Quran and attending prayers
  • Developing self-discipline and empathy for the less fortunate
